On Tue, Jan 05, 2010 at 09:28:36AM +0100, Peter Zijlstra wrote:
> On Mon, 2010-01-04 at 18:43 -0800, Paul E. McKenney wrote:
> > On Mon, Jan 04, 2010 at 07:24:33PM +0100, Peter Zijlstra wrote:
> > > TODO:
> > > - should be SRCU, lack of call_srcu()
> > >
> > > In order to allow speculative vma lookups, RCU free the struct
> > > vm_area_struct.
> > >
> > > We use two means of detecting a vma is still valid:
> > > - firstly, we set RB_CLEAR_NODE once we remove a vma from the tree.
> > > - secondly, we check the vma sequence number.
> > >
> > > These two things combined will guarantee that 1) the vma is still
> > > present and two, it still covers the same range from when we looked it
> > > up.
> >
> > OK, I think I see what you are up to here. I could get you a very crude
> > throw-away call_srcu() fairly quickly. I don't yet have a good estimate
> > of how long it will take me to merge SRCU into the treercu infrastructure,
> > but am getting there.
> >
> > So, which release are you thinking in terms of?
>
> I'm not thinking any release yet, its very early and as Linus has
> pointed out, I seem to have forgotten a rather big piece of the
> picture :/
>
> So I need to try and fix this glaring hole before we can continue.
OK, then I will think in terms of merging SRCU into treercu before
providing any sort of call_srcu().
Thanx, Paul
